Congenital thrombotic thrombocytopenic purpura (cTTP) is a rare autosomal recessive microangiopathic disorder caused by inherited mutations in the ADAMTS13 gene. cTTP treatment involves infusing ADAMTS13-rich blood products like fresh frozen plasma (FFP) to replenish levels and prevent disease relapses. Alternative therapies like recombinant ADAMTS13, plasma-derived Factor VIII, or caplacizumab may be used for patients unable to tolerate FFP.
